Jurgen Klopp provides James Milner injury update after Liverpool beat Everton

Jurgen Klopp fears James Milner may have picked up a ‘serious’ muscle injury during Liverpool’s 1-0 victory over Everton.

Milner managed only nine minutes of the FA Cup third round tie before hobbling off the field and Yasser Larouci came on in place of the midfielder at Anfield.

Curtis Jones won the game for Liverpool with one of the great Merseyside derby goals in the 71st minute and Klopp’s side will discover their fourth round opponents on Monday night.

Liverpool were already short of options in midfield before Sunday’s match – with both Fabinho and Naby Keita sidelined – and Milner’s injury may hit the Reds hard ahead of a their clashes with Tottenham and Manchester United.

Klopp revealed that Milner was in some pain and the German is concerned he may be out of action for a while.

Asked about Milner’s injury after Liverpool’s win, Klopp said: ‘Two players started the last game and one of them got injured, so that’s the situation we are in.

‘That’s why a lot of managers make a lot of changes; it’s nothing to do with the cup, it’s the timing.

‘Milner has pain, that says it’s serious. It’s [his] muscle.’

Klopp showered Liverpool wonderkid Jones with praise after his ‘sensational’ strike in the second half.

He said: ‘Unbelievable individual performances from the kids and the adults as well.

‘Adam Lallana – what a game, unbelievable. Joe Gomez – organising the whole defence for maybe the first time in his life.

‘Sensational game and a sensational goal from a Scouser – who could ask for more? You cannot perform like the boys performed if you think you should not perform in that team.

‘They all think like that. I am so happy they all showed up tonight. The only thing I didn’t want was a draw. We had to take some risks and it paid off.’
